Software Engineer [$243k/yr+] TS/SCI-FS Poly

SYSTOLIC, INC.
Jessup, United States of America
27 days ago

Role details

Contract type
Permanent contract
Employment type
Full-time (> 32 hours)
Working hours
Regular working hours
Languages
English
Experience level
Senior
Compensation
$ 243K

Job location

Jessup, United States of America

Tech stack

Testing (Software)
Artificial Intelligence
Algorithm Design
Amazon Web Services (AWS)
Systems Engineering
C++
Cloud Computing
Databases
DevOps
Python
Machine Learning
Software Architecture
Software Deployment
Software Engineering
Software Systems
Data Streaming
Data Processing
High Performance Computing
Reliability of Systems
Infrastructure Automation Frameworks
Terraform
Go

Job description

  • Develop, maintain, and enhance complex software systems, advanced algorithms, and Artificial Intelligence/Machine Learning applications.
  • Program with proficiency in C++, Python, and Go, leveraging these languages for high-performance solutions.
  • Design and manage cloud infrastructure using Terraform and AWS, supporting robust software deployments.
  • Work extensively with high-performance computing (HPC) and streaming data analytic systems, ensuring efficient data processing.
  • Lead efforts in software architecture design, systems engineering, and database management.
  • Drive software testing initiatives, conduct thorough requirements analysis, and provide technical leadership to development teams., * Design, develop, and maintain complex software systems and applications, applying strong software development principles.
  • Architect and engineer robust software solutions, including systems for high-performance computing (HPC) and streaming analytics.
  • Implement advanced algorithms and develop Machine Learning/Artificial Intelligence models to solve complex problems, leveraging mathematical foundations.
  • Write clean, efficient, and well-documented code primarily in C++, Python, and Go.
  • Utilize Terraform and AWS to automate infrastructure provisioning, configuration, and management, embracing DevOps practices.
  • Conduct comprehensive requirements analysis to define system specifications and ensure alignment with project goals.
  • Perform thorough software testing, integration, and verification activities (I&T) to ensure system reliability and performance.
  • Design, implement, and manage scalable database solutions as a Database Engineer.
  • Provide technical team leadership, mentoring junior engineers, and guiding project execution.
  • Create and maintain technical documentation and foster effective communication and technical writing within the team.

Requirements

Degree: Technical bachelor's degree or equivalent experience Years of experience: 7+ years Salary: $243k+ yearly compensation

Apply for this position